Is retaining an unused "Mubarak Housing for Youth" apartment, and falsely claiming ownership of it to avoid returning it to the New Urban Communities Authority, considered taking what is not rightfully mine from a religious perspective?

1 min readAlso available in العربية

If the state subsidizes apartments and stipulates their occupancy for low-income individuals, then ownership is not permissible except for those who meet the conditions, based on the hadith: "Muslims are bound by their conditions in what is permissible." Accordingly, your brother's ownership of the apartment is not valid due to his not residing in it, and your purchase of it from him is not permissible. It is obligatory to return it to the authority. However, if the state does not subsidize the apartments and does not impose conditions, then your ownership of it is valid, and you may dispose of it, and it is permissible to lie to protect your right to it.
